1 Dead, 1 Wounded In Early-Morning Shooting Outside SF Bar

SAN FRANCISCO (CBS SF) -- Police are investigating a shooting that killed on man and sent another to a hospital early Sunday morning in downtown San Francisco.

Around 2 a.m., officers responded to a bar in the 900 block of Geary Boulevard, according to police.

Officers learned patrons leaving a bar had become involved in a physical fight. The dispute had subsided when a car allegedly pulled up to the area, police said.

A suspect then got out of the car and fired several shots, according to police.

One man was pronounced dead at the scene. Another man was taken to a hospital with injuries not considered life-threatening, police said.

Information about the suspect or the suspect vehicle was not immediately available.
